The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.

In the 1881 Census, the household of Stephen Fowler, born in 1836 in Peasmarsh, Sussex, consisted of 3 members. Stephen was the head of the household, widower. He had 2 children; Catherine (born 1863 in Peasmarsh, Sussex, England) and William (born 1869 in Peasmarsh, Sussex, England).
